We use IP addresses to analyze trends, administer the site, track clients' movements, and gather broad demographic information for aggregate use. IP addresses are not linked to personally identifiable information. We may occasionally report aggregated demographic information in the form of reports and statistics but this is not linked to any personal information that can be used to identify any individual person.

Some of YQG's sub-systems require the use of "cookies". For example, we use cookies when you purchase goods or services over the Internet to save the contents of your "shopping basket" as you proceed from one screen to another. YQG uses "per-session" cookies only. Per-session cookies are small files that are temporarily stored in your computer's memory and are deleted when you leave YQG's website.
